WebJun 2, 2024 · Allusion is a reference to a well-known person, character, place, or event that a writer makes to deepen the reader’s understanding of their work. Allusions aren’t reserved for writing, though—we frequently use them in our speech. An allusion is a concise way to communicate a lot of meaning. WebObama's allusion to "Harlem," however, offered only one acknowledgment of Hughes, who appears in Obama's speech almost as an adversary to hope and change. But when Obama nodded to King during his acceptance speech, it was Hughes who winked back.
